Health services put on high alert to tackle emergencies

Lucknow: All govt hospital staff have been put on high alert to manage emergencies during Holi. Following deputy CM Brajesh Pathak’s directive, doctors and paramedical teams will remain on duty.

Pathak highlighted concerns like road accidents, skin issues from chemical-based colours, and health complications arising from rich festive foods. To tackle these, hospitals will be stocked with essential medicines.

Officials said in case of emergencies, one must dial 108 for a swift response. Pregnant women and children will receive priority care through the 102 ambulance service. TVSK Reddy, senior VPof EMRI Green, said, “In emergencies such as accidents, burns, heart attacks, one must call 108 for a free ambulance.
